[QUOTE="FrogReaver, post: 7797864, member: 6795602"] So going back to the shield vs mage armor question. I'm going to assume shield only provides an estimated +3 AC bonus because you will only use it on attacks that are sure things and oftentimes you just don't know the attack of the creature your fighting to enough certainity to take advantage of it all the way to the +5 range. Even in this situation: If you face 3 attacks total on different rounds of the adventuring day then mage armor only has about 6.075% higher chance than shield to deflect more attacks. However, you have a 61.4% chance of not needing benefiting from shield or mage armor. That's an extra spell slot 61,4% of the time, except that you would have needed to already cast mage armor but you didn't already have to cast shield. I'm coming around to shield being generally better. It isn't strictly always better but I think a strong case can be made that it's generally better. [/QUOTE]
